Just wondering if this is normal for some snakes or species. Got my Brooks kingsnake as a juvenile and have had him for 2.5 years. For most of that time he will have two sheds in a short span of time and then go a significantly longer period of time before the next shed. He is 3 years old now and his shedding cycle goes something like shed 1, a few weeks to a month later shed 2, several months later shed 3, a month later shed 4. Occasionally there will be 2 sheds with long intervals between, but he always goes back to having two sheds close together. All his sheds are complete. And he seems very healthy. Is this shedding pattern somewhat normal?
My rat snake, on the other hand, has a regular schedule of having the same interval between all his sheds. This is what I expected and it just makes me wonder more about my kingsnake.
